IQB mbrs. fire 1 manufactured Grad rocket fr. Gaza into Israel, striking nr. Ashqelon, causing damage but no injuries, marking a serious escalation; the last time Ashqelon was hit by Palestinian rocket fire was in 2/09. Several hrs. later, unidentified Palestinians fire 2 mortars fr. Gaza into Israel, causing no damage or injuries. In response, the IDF carries out 3 air strikes targeting a training camp for the Hamas-affiliated police in Gaza City (wounding 5 policemen and 16 bystanders, damaging 30 surrounding buildings) and smuggling tunnels on the Rafah border (causing no reported injuries). In the West Bank, the IDF patrols in Bayt Liqya village nr. Ramallah at midday without incident; conducts late-night arrest raids, house searches nr. Hebron. Palestinians (sometimes accompanied by Israeli and international activists) hold weekly nonviolent demonstrations against the separation wall and land confiscations in Bil‘in (a 45- mbr. Spanish delegation and a 30-mbr. German delegation take part), Ni‘lin, and Dayr Nizam/al-Nabi Salih. IDF soldiers fire rubber-coated steel bullets, tear gas, and stun grenades at the protesters, leaving scores suffering tear gas inhalation and arresting 1 Palestinian and 1 international activist. Jewish settlers fr. Brakha nr. Nablus set fire to 100 olive trees and large tracks of agricultural land; IDF soldiers initially fire tear gas and stun grenades at Palestinian civil defense workers who attempt to put out the fire, but finally let the firefighters pass more than half an hour later, after the PA liaison dept. intervenes. (HA, JP, YA 7/30; HA, NYT, WP 7/31; IFM, MEZ 8/1; PCHR 8/5; OCHA 8/13)

Overnight, the IDF makes 3 air strikes on smuggling tunnels on the Rafah border and 1 air strike on an iron pipe store in Nussayrat r.c. in retaliation for Palestinian rocket fire on 7/24, destroying the shop and cutting electricity around Nussayrat, but causing no injuries. In the West Bank, the IDF patrols in 2 villages nr. Tulkarm in the morning, making no arrests; conducts late-night arrest raids, house searches in Tulkarm; makes a late-night raid on the Qalqilya home of the PA Undersecy. for Civil Affairs Ma‘ruf Zahran while he is on vacation in Turkey, searching the home and arresting his son. Jewish settlers escorted by IDF troops enter Nablus to pray at Joseph’s Tomb. In 2 separate incidents nr. Nablus, Jewish settlers attack and vandalize Palestinian homes, in 1 case also setting fire to nearby olive groves. (IDF 7/26; PCHR 7/29; OCHA 7/30)

The IDF makes a brief incursion into s. Gaza to level lands e. of al-Qarara village to clear lines of sight, firing at Palestinians in the area but causing no injuries. In 2 separate incidents on the Rafah border, 1 Palestinian is fatally electrocuted in a smuggling tunnel, 4 are injured in a tunnel collapse. In the West Bank, the IDF conducts late-night arrest raids, house searches in Tulkarm, nr. Hebron. (OCHA, PCHR 7/22)

Israel reports that a Libyan ship that had threatened to run the Gaza blockade (see 7/11) has diverted toward the Egyptian port of al-Arish, defusing a potential crisis; the Egyptian Red Crescent Society will take the goods to Gaza through the Rafah terminal. (Israel had been urging Egypt and Italy to intervene with Libya to encourage it to divert the boat.) Meanwhile, IDF troops on the c. Gaza border shell residential areas of Gaza Valley village after spotting “suspicious figures” in the area, hitting 1 home, killing 1 Palestinian woman and wounding 3 civilians in and around the house. Israeli naval vessels fire on Palestinian fishing boats off the n. Gaza coast, forcing them back to shore. In the West Bank, the IDF conducts late-night arrest raids, house searches nr. Jenin, Salfit. Israeli authorities demolish 6 Palestinian homes in and around East Jerusalem (3 in Issawiyya, 1 in Bayt Hanina, 2 in Jabal Mukabir). (NYT, WP, WT 7/14; PCHR 7/15; OCHA 7/16)
